Raul has been a great success at Bundesliga side Schalke, he scored 19 goals in his first season and has netted 20 times in this campaign so far. Signed on a free, many doubted whether he'd be able to produce such a return and he's answered any doubters easily.

The fans love him, he's even climbed into their section and sang songs with the Ultras following games. His impact is hard to overestimate but Schalke themselves have managed it.

The Spaniard today announced he'd be leaving the club at the end of the season and is looking to play football outside of Europe, Marca saying the Middle East. Schalke offered Raul, who is 35 in June, an extra year on his contract but he wants a two year deal and as such will be off.

His press conference today was emotional and there can be no doubt that he's as fond of the club as they are of him,Raul is quoted on the club website as saying

"After long and careful consideration I have decided not to play for FC Schalke 04 next season. It took me a very long time to reach this decision and it was a very

difficult one for me to take.

"Schalke fans really are something special. They've shown me an incredible amount of love and affection over the last two years. It's hard for me to find the right words to describe it. To come anywhere near to paying back the fans for what they have given me, I should have scored lots more goals and won more titles."

That's all brilliant and we wish him all the best. But what's all this about Schalke retiring the number 7 shirt in his honour? Bild quote Schalke Executive Horst Heldt as saying "The number 7 is no longer awarded for an indefinite time at Schalke."

It seems incredibly extreme for a player who has only represented the club for two years. What would happen if they had a real lifelong club legend call it a day, stop playing football? It may have been an emotional reaction that hasn't been thought out properly but if teams start retiring shirts for such reasons then we could be in treble figures for shirt numbers before we know it.
